h1{margin-top:2rem;margin-bottom:2rem;font-family:proxima-sera,sans-serif;font-style:normal;font-weight:600;font-size:2.25rem;line-height:1.08}h2{margin-top:0;margin-bottom:0;font-family:proxima-sera,sans-serif;font-style:normal;font-weight:600;font-size:2rem;line-height:1.08}h3{margin-top:2rem;margin-bottom:2rem;font-family:proxima-sera,sans-serif;font-style:normal;font-weight:600;font-size:2.25rem;line-height:1.08}h4{margin-top:1rem;margin-bottom:1rem;font-family:proxima-sera,sans-serif;font-style:normal;font-weight:600;font-size:1.125rem;line-height:1.2}h5{margin-top:1rem;margin-bottom:1rem;font-family:Proxima Nova,serif;font-style:normal;font-weight:600;font-size:1rem;line-height:1.5rem}p{margin-top:1rem;margin-bottom:1rem;font-family:Proxima Nova,sans-serif;font-style:normal;font-weight:400;font-size:.875rem;line-height:1.375rem}p.alert{font-weight:600;color:#d50430}small{font-family:Proxima Nova,sans-serif;font-style:normal;font-weight:400;font-size:.8125rem;line-height:.8125rem}a{color:#303030;color:#002b3b}a:hover,a:focus{color:#005aac;color:#aa5745;text-decoration:underline}ul{margin:0;padding:0;list-style:none}ul li{font-size:.875rem;line-height:1.375rem}.text-content ul li{list-style:none;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;margin-bottom:.75rem}.text-content ul li:before{content:"";display:inline-block;position:relative;top:-.125rem;width:.375rem;height:.375rem;margin-right:1.5rem;vertical-align:middle;border-radius:.375rem;background-color:#e81818;background-color:#aa5745}.text-content ul li:before{top:.625rem}.text-content ul li:last-child{margin-bottom:0}.text-content ul li span{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1}.Collection-title{max-width:47.5rem;margin:0 0 1.5rem;text-align:center}.Collection .HeaderDropdown-featured{display:block;position:relative;left:-.9375rem;width:calc(100% + 30px);margin-bottom:2.25rem;padding:0!important}.Collection .HeaderDropdown-featured .HeaderDropdown-image{display:block;border-radius:0}.Collection-description{max-width:100%;margin:1.5rem 0 2.5rem;text-align:left}.Collection-filters{position:fixed;top:0;left:0;width:100%;height:100vh;padding-bottom:2rem;opacity:0;background-color:#fff;pointer-events:none;z-index:100;overflow-y:auto}.Collection-filters.open{opacity:1;pointer-events:all;z-index:10000}.Collection-filters-buttons{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;padding:.75rem 0;border-bottom:.0625rem solid #dadada;border-bottom:.0625rem solid #F5F4F2}.Collection-filters-heading{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;padding:2rem 0 1.5rem;border-bottom:.0625rem solid #dadada;border-bottom:.0625rem solid #F5F4F2}.Collection-filters-heading h4{width:50%;font-size:1.5rem;text-align:left}.Collection-filters-heading .Collection-tag-clear{display:block;width:50%;text-align:right}.Collection-filters-back{width:2.5rem;height:2.5rem}.Collection-filters .ac{margin-top:0;margin-bottom:0;border:0}.Collection-filters .accordion-container{overflow:hidden}.Collection-filters .ac-q{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;padding:1.5rem 0;border-bottom:.0625rem solid #AFA797;cursor:pointer}.Collection-filters .ac-q span{font-weight:700}.Collection-filters .ac-q:after{display:none}.Collection-filters .ac-q[aria-expanded=true] .icon{-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}.Collection-filters .ac-a{padding:0;overflow:hidden;clear:both;max-height:0;-webkit-transition:max-height .25s ease-in-out;transition:max-height .25s ease-in-out}.Collection-filters .ac-a.is-open{max-height:25rem;overflow-y:auto}.Collection-filters .ac-a label{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;margin-bottom:.75rem;cursor:pointer}.Collection-filters .ac-a label:first-child{padding-top:2rem}.Collection-filters .ac-a label.--color{width:95%;float:left}.Collection-filters .ac-a label input{display:block;margin-right:.75rem;cursor:pointer}.Collection-filters .ac-a label.is-refined span{font-weight:600}.Collection-filters i{display:inline-block;width:2.875rem;height:auto;margin-right:1rem;vertical-align:middle;pointer-events:none}.Collection-filters i svg{fill:transparent}.Collection-filters i.icon{width:1.875rem;margin-left:auto;margin-right:0;-webkit-transition:-webkit-transform .25s linear;transition:-webkit-transform .25s linear;transition:transform .25s linear;transition:transform .25s linear,-webkit-transform .25s linear}.Collection-filters-container{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-flow:column wrap;-ms-flex-flow:column wrap;flex-flow:column wrap;-webkit-box-align:start;-webkit-align-items:flex-start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start}.Collection-filters-container .accordion-container{width:100%}.Collection-filters-container .accordion-container:first-child .ac-q{padding-top:0}.Collection-results{display:block;margin-bottom:1.5rem;padding:1.5rem 1.25rem 0 1.25em}.Collection-results-txt{display:block;font-weight:400;font-size:1rem;color:#736a59}.Collection-results-txt-placeholder{height:24px;width:125px}.Collection-tags{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;-webkit-box-ordinal-group:3;-webkit-order:2;-ms-flex-order:2;order:2;width:100%}.Collection-tag{display:inline-block;margin-right:.5rem;margin-bottom:1rem;padding:.25rem .75rem;text-align:center;border-radius:.5rem;background:#dadada;background:#f5f4f2}.Collection-tag i{display:inline-block;width:1.125rem;vertical-align:middle;cursor:pointer}.Collection-tag-clear{display:none;font-weight:600;font-size:.875rem;text-decoration:underline;color:#a3a3a3;color:#736a59;cursor:pointer}.Collection-tag-clear:hover{text-decoration:none}.Collection-tag-clear:disabled{display:none!important}.Collection-controls{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row wrap;-ms-flex-flow:row wrap;flex-flow:row wr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;margin:0 0 .5rem;padding:0}.Collection-controls:before,.Collection-controls:after{display:table;content:" "}.Collection-controls:after{clear:both}.Collection-control{-webkit-box-ordinal-group:2;-webkit-order:1;-ms-flex-order:1;order:1;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:end;-webkit-justify-content:end;-ms-flex-pack:end;justify-content:end;width:100%;margin-bottom:2rem}.Collection-control.sticky{top:auto!important;left:0!important;bottom:0!important;width:100%!important;margin-bottom:0;padding:.75rem .9375rem;background-color:#dddedc;z-index:90}.Collection-control label{display:none;font-weight:600;font-size:.875rem;text-transform:none}.Collection-controlLabel{display:inline-block;vertical-align:middle;max-width:7rem;padding:0 1.5rem 0 0;text-align:left;text-transform:uppercase}.Collection-controlSelector{display:inline-block;vertical-align:middle;width:50%;margin:0;margin-left:.375rem}.Collection-controlFilters{display:inline-block;width:50%;height:2.75rem;margin-right:.375rem;padding:.375rem 2rem .375rem 1rem;font-size:1rem;text-align:left;border-radius:.25rem;outline:0;border:.0625rem solid #AFA797;background:#fff url(//www.mantelsdirect.com/cdn/shop/t/355/assets/icon-chevron-right.svg?v=133992370414447204891753965667) no-repeat center right 20px/8px auto}.Collection-bottomtext h1.title{font-family:proxima-sera,sans-serif;font-size:42px;font-style:normal;font-weight:600;line-height:38px;letter-spacing:0em;color:#0a0909;margin-bottom:1.5rem;margin-top:0}.Collection-bottomtext div.freeShip img{height:24px;width:24px;margin-right:8px}.Collection-bottomtext div.freeShip{font-family:Proxima Nova;font-size:16px;font-style:normal;font-weight:600;line-height:24px;letter-spacing:0em;text-align:left;color:#aa5745;margin-bottom:1rem}.Collection-bottomtext div.description{margin-bottom:1rem}#shopify-section-algolia-collection{min-height:950px}.offerLabel{background:#f5f7f2;color:#677d4a;padding:.25rem .5rem;font-size:14px;font-weight:600;display:-webkit-inline-box;display:-webkit-inline-flex;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center}.offerLabel svg{margin-right:.5rem}.current_price .offerLabel{background:#784330;color:#fff}.GridItem .offerLabel svg path{stroke:#677d4a}.Badge{font-weight:400;font-size:.875rem;text-align:center;padding:.25rem .5rem;margin:0;color:#303030;color:#002b3b;text-transform:capitalize;text-decoration:none!important;-webkit-box-flex:0;-webkit-flex:0 0 auto;-ms-flex:0 0 auto;flex:0 0 auto;border-radius:.25rem 0;background:#f5d6cc;position:absolute;top:0;left:0;z-index:10}.template-product .Badge{top:16px;left:16px;border-radius:.25rem}.Card-info .offerLabel{margin-bottom:15px}@media print,screen and (min-width: 40em){h1{font-size:3.25rem;line-height:1.1}h4{font-size:1.5rem;line-height:1.2}h5{font-size:1.125rem}p,ul li{font-size:1rem;line-height:1.625rem}.text-content ul li{margin-bottom:1rem}.Collection .HeaderDropdown-featured{display:none}.Collection-filters{position:relative;top:auto;left:auto;width:33.3333333333%;height:auto;opacity:1;pointer-events:all;z-index:auto}.Collection-filters-buttons,.Collection-controlFilters{display:none}}@media print,screen and (min-width: 64em){h1{font-size:5.5rem;line-height:1.1}h1.--alt{font-size:3.5rem}h2{font-size:3rem}.Collection-filters{width:25%}}@media screen and (min-width: 50em){.Collection-title{text-align:left}.Collection-description{margin:1.5rem 0 4rem}.Collection-filters-heading{display:none}.Collection-tags{-webkit-box-ordinal-group:2;-webkit-order:1;-ms-flex-order:1;order:1;width:auto}.Collection-tag-clear{display:inline-block}.Collection-controls{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row nowrap;-ms-flex-flow:row nowrap;flex-flow:row nowrap;padding:0 1rem}.Collection-control{-webkit-box-ordinal-group:3;-webkit-order:2;-ms-flex-order:2;order:2;width:auto;margin-left:auto;margin-bottom:1rem}.Collection-control label{display:block}.Collection-controlSelector{width:11rem;margin-left:0}}@media (min-width: 1600px){.Collection-products{width:calc(100% - 375px)}.Collection-filters{width:375px;padding-left:0}.Collection-results{padding-left:0}.Collection-bottomtext>.row .large-12{padding-left:0}#shopify-section-algolia-collection,.template-collection .row,.template-search .row{max-width:96%}.template-collection #Breadcrumbs .row,.template-search #Breadcrumbs .row{padding-left:0}.quiz-block h4{margin-right:2em}.quiz-block a.Button{margin-left:auto}}@media (min-width: 767px) and (max-width: 1600px){.Collection-filters{width:calc(25% - 1.25rem)}}
/*# sourceMappingURL=/cdn/shop/t/355/assets/collection.css.map */
